Ducati Multistrada V4 S 2021

Ducati Multistrada V4 S 2021

In the past, the exclusive dream motorbikes usually came from the class of sports bikes. But with the new Multistrada, Ducati delivers a real banger in the touring enduro league. The bike rides through the radii with playful ease. So you are perfectly capable of using the exuberant power every now and then. The great experience is garnished by the extensive electronics package, which sets the bar very high overall.

Great enduro feeling paired with smart elegance

Honda CB500X 2021

Honda CB500X 2021

Honda's A2 all-rounder has evolved positively! Components such as brakes and chassis have been noticeably upgraded, while the new paintwork and headlight signature also make a clear statement about the 2022 vintage. Get on and go is the motto here, because thanks to the easy handling and accessible ergonomics, you feel comfortable on this 48 hp touring enduro after just a few metres. Young or old - the CB500X has a place for everyone!
